Skilled manpower is a key competetive advantage for any organization toward a knowledge-based development. "Skill Training System", with such an important duty, is under influence of science & technology development, so it is neccesary to investigate the effects of new technological concepts as "Technological Convergence". This study uses "Environmental Scanning" to foresight "Convergent Technologies" in skill training system and the results show that all components of the system (Inputs, Processes, Outputs & Outcomes) will be changed by those Technologies (Nano, Bio, ICT & Cognitive Sciences) in future.

Purpose: The present study aims to identify and explain the futures of Iranian provinces in the competition for the development of NBIC technological convergence (synergy between nanotechnology, biotechnology, information technology and cognitive sciences) with a focus on Yazd province. Method: This research, which has been conducted with a qualitative and descriptive approach, is classified as an exploratory futures-study. In this way, the relevant research records were first reviewed to compile a list of drivers in the development of Convergent Technologies. The list was then refined and prioritized to identify two key drivers, with the Delphi process attended by fourteen experts. By intersecting the uncertainties of these two drivers, four scenarios of the province's future in technological convergence competition emerged. Findings: The two key drivers affecting the success of the province in the competition for Convergent Technologies are: the rate of development of the innovation ecosystem and the amount of financial resources allocated to this process. Based on this, four scenarios of the future situation of the province in this field were identified, which have been named as "Vanguard", "Buyer", "Remnant" and "Hired". Conclusion: In order for the provinces to be able to succeed in the forthcoming competitions in the production and operation of Convergent Technologies, it is necessary to plan for strengthening the ecosystem infrastructure from now; at the same time, it is necessary to make efficient efforts to provide sufficient financial resources for the research and commercialization of these Technologies.

Purpose: The aim is paper to study and compare subject fields contributing in converging Technologies (biotechnology, nanotechnology, infor-mation technology and cognitive science) sci-entific output in Iran (2001-2015) and find out about their com-mon and uncommon subfields. Methodology: This applied study uses bib-liometric techniques. The data gathered from Scopus. Findings: The largest number of articles be-longed to Bio, Nano, Info and cognitive sciences respectively. The highest growth rate occurred during the period belonged to nano, info, cognitive and bio sciences re-spectively. Conclusion: Diversity of subjects contribu-tion to nano and bio sciences was more than cognitive and in-formation sciences. Biochemistry, genetics and molecular biology, medicine, computer sciences, engineering and ‘ pharmacology, toxicology and pharmaceutics’ were common in all four areas. Chemistry and material science were the fields that could massively impact nano, bio and infor-mation sciences.

There is now a competitive race between some countries to code the human brain. Technology is advancing in such a way that it has influenced and even controlled the brain and therefore the behavior of enemy soldiers. Ground-breaking Technologies in neuroscience have enabled mankind to achieve new types of non-destructive weapons to manipulate the human operating system (brain). These include neurotherapic drugs to change behavior, remote monitoring of human brain activity using electromagnetic waves, acoustic weapons that send sound beams directly into the soldiers' skulls, and even holographic projection and other symbols of a complex battlefield. In the current research, the author proves that the focal point of war activities now and in the future will be around achieving the psychological effects of war. In this situation, there is no need for military actions in the physical field and the costs will be significantly reduced. The descriptive-analytical research examines the functions of cognitive warfare using Convergent Technologies, neocortical and neural weapons as groundbreaking Technologies.

Among the required infrastructures for a society to develop, the administrative system, specially the one that is influenced by Convergent Technologies (NBIC) plays a vital role. The purpose of this paper is a futures study on iran’ s administrative system under the influence of Convergent Technologies. At the initial stage, we identified 51 possible achievements of Convergent Technologies in various aspects of human life by environmental scanning. Next by using a Delphi technique, we collected and analyzed the views of 74 Iranian experts who were specialist in the fields of technological convergence. Finally, by using the morphological analysis technique, the future status of the administrative system of Iran is depicted in several scenarios. Findings show that, the probability of occurrence of 19 achievements of NBIC's convergence in a ten-years period will be "very high" and "high", and on the other hand, multiple dimensions of the administrative system is under the influence of NBIC’ s achievements. The results also explain the way Iran’ s admiristrative reform will be influenced by the NBIC. Furthermore, the research triple scenarios (optimistic, pessimistic and median), will help the Iran’ s policy makers and higher civil servants to select a path of technological convergence that is most suitable for the country’ s administrative system.

The present study attempts to introduce the role and function of the government in innovative capability building under the influence of the technological convergence flow as a foresight study and introduce the predictable futures of Convergent Technologies (NBIC). The approach of this research is qualitative and descriptive and has been used in morphological and scenario-building strategies. Thus, the most common mechanisms of public support in the process of innovation capability enhancement are identified and modeled; in parallel, the most important achievements of Convergent Technologies are derived from one of the valid models. Then, the intensity of the impacts of technological convergence on each aspect of governmental support is estimated through expert panel & morphological analysis techniques. Finally, by implementing the scenario-building technique, three alternative scenarios of the future (including minimal, moderate, and maximum scenarios) are designed. The results show that by utilizing intelligently the revolutionary capacities of Convergent Technologies, the governments can establish the desirable future of the role of governance in development of innovative capabilities, and this position can be evolved strongly compared to the current situation.

Purpose: The future of the construction industry is increasingly influenced by new Technologies. In order to adopt appropriate strategies in facing new Technologies, it is necessary to know the possible futures of the construction industry. This research was done with the aim of explaining the technological uncertainties and compiling the future scenarios of the construction industry.  Method: The research method is applied and was carried out with a combination of quantitative and qualitative methods. First, the library study was used to determine the technological drivers, then the Structural Analysis was used to explain the technological uncertainties, and finally, the Schwartz method was used to compile the scenarios. The statistical population is experts of construction industry. Findings: Nine technological uncertainties affecting the future of the construction industry have been identified and for each of them, three states of decline, stagnation and progress have been considered. Data analysis by Scenario Wizard shows eight probable scenarios. The portfolio of scenarios including four groups of progress scenarios, towards progress, towards stagnation, and towards wane has been compiled. Conclusion: In the progress scenario, the 89% of uncertainties have developed. In  towards progress, 56% of the factors are in the development status, which indicates the development of the technological factor application. In the stagnation scenario, no progress has been made in the application of uncertainties and they are in a static state. In towards wane, uncertainties have been placed in a situation of reduced use.

Critical assessment of social changes and the impact of factors which, through their mutual interactions, shape the outlooks and ways of life of people and societies are among the major concerns of contemporary philosophers who would like to use their theoretical knowledge to tackle applied problems. In the present paper we try to assess, from a philosophical and critical point of view based on Critical Rationalism, some of the socio-cultural impacts of wide-ranging changes caused due to unprecedented developments in the converging sciences & Technologies. The first part of the paper deals with a brief introduction of the notion of the fourth wave of scientific and Technologies development due to developments in the following four fields: Nano, Bio, Info, and Cogno (NBIC). In the second part of the paper we discuss some of the most important socio-cultural consequences of the developments in NBIC sciences and Technologies. The main aim of this philosophical investigation is to consider the options open to modern man vis-à-vis new developments in sciences and Technologies. In the last part of the paper some policy recommendations with regard to the issues discussed are introduced. It is hoped that the proposed recommendations prove to be useful for the policy-makers in Iran.
